Is everyone in your company working together towards a common goal?  Or do people often seem to work at odds with each other?  An effective strategic planning system aligns all aspects of your company, from its Mission, Vision and Values to the day-to-day actions of your staff.

Developing Mission, Vision and Values 

The starting point for working together has to be the purpose and character of the company, expressed as Mission (what you do), Vision (where you want to go) and Values (what is important.)  This gives your organization its True North.

Strategic Planning

Effective business strategies come from ruthlessly comparing current external and internal realities with the Mission, Vision and Values of the company.   Each business cycle, the whole organization ought to engage in this planning.

 

Marketing Strategies 

Customer needs comprise the core of the marketing strategy.  Disciplined strategic planning keeps you in touch with evolving customer behavior, technology, competition, profitability and other factors.

Effective Project Management  

Strategy gets executed through Projects.  Project Management is a vital business skill, necessary for all levels in an organization.

Open Space Technology

This technology focuses large groups of people, engaging them in constructive and creative conversation. OST is a highly participative process that works with groups of 25 to 500. In Open Space participants create and manage multiple agendas in parallel working sessions around a central theme of strategic importance. Using OST is powerful because participants effectively connect and strengthen what is already happening in an organization.
